**Ticket: Config drift on BounceSift processor**

The email bounce processor in the Larkfield environment has drifted from the values committed in the release branch. Retry windows and suppression thresholds no longer match, which likely explains the duplicate suppression entries reported Tuesday. Please reconcile before the Thursday cut. For reference, the currently deployed configuration on the live node reads as follows.

config for yajep-yahof:
[briax]
port = 9200
region = outer-2
host = briax.nelvrocorp.test
team = raleth
timeout_ms = 1500
retries = 1

Alert: BranchReaper cleanup job exceeded its deletion threshold.

The bot attempted to remove more stale branches than its configured safety cap allows and has paused itself pending review. No branches were deleted. Please verify the staleness criteria haven't been misconfigured before resuming, as release branches are exempt only when correctly labeled. Resume instructions and the exemption list are on the internal page below.

wiki page, tahaf-tajog: https://jira.ordindyn.corp/pipeline

Each instance requires a dedicated service account with queue-read and device-write scopes, nothing broader. Job payloads are held in an encrypted scratch volume that is wiped on restart, so persistent volumes are unnecessary and discouraged. Health probes expose no job metadata. Before approving a rollout, verify the manifest matches the hardening baseline. The production deployment applies these configuration values.

settings of fafog-haduf:
ZORIX_PIN=4648
ZORIX_METRICS_HOST=metrics.zorix.paliqsys.corp
ZORIX_LOG_LEVEL=info
ZORIX_TENANT=druix

## Deploying the Gatewick Proctor Queue

Deploys are pretty painless: push to main, wait for the pipeline, then watch the queue drain dashboard for five minutes. If candidates pile up mid-exam, roll back first and ask questions later — the queue replays safely. Everything the workers care about lives in one config block, shown here for reference.

settings of bafof-yagef:
JOROX_PIN=8740
JOROX_TENANT=pelox
JOROX_METRICS_HOST=metrics.jorox.qorvelworks.internal
JOROX_SEAL=seal_c78f63c1
JOROX_STANDBY_TEAM=norax